Meaning: The quote "If you're not actively involved in getting what you want, you don't really want it" by Peter McWilliams, an American author, is a powerful statement that encapsulates the essence of desire, determination, and action. This quote suggests that true desire is manifested through active involvement and pursuit of one's goals. It implies that merely wishing for something is not enough; one must take tangible steps and exert effort to achieve it.

At its core, this quote speaks to the idea that true desire is accompanied by a willingness to work for what one wants. It emphasizes the importance of proactive engagement and determination in the pursuit of one's aspirations. In essence, it challenges individuals to question the authenticity of their desires by examining their level of commitment and effort towards achieving them.

The quote also underscores the concept of personal responsibility and agency in shaping one's life. It suggests that individuals have the power to actively pursue their goals and make their desires a reality. This notion aligns with the idea that success and fulfillment are often the result of deliberate action and perseverance. It serves as a reminder that individuals have the ability to influence their circumstances through their choices and actions.

Furthermore, the quote highlights the distinction between mere wishful thinking and genuine intent. It suggests that passive longing or daydreaming about a goal is not indicative of a true desire unless it is accompanied by concrete steps and active engagement. This distinction is crucial in understanding the difference between fleeting thoughts and genuine, deep-seated aspirations.

From a motivational perspective, this quote serves as a call to action for individuals to assess their level of commitment towards their goals. It encourages self-reflection and introspection, prompting individuals to evaluate whether they are truly dedicated to realizing their desires. By emphasizing the importance of active involvement, the quote promotes a mindset of determination, resilience, and accountability in the pursuit of one's ambitions.

In the context of personal development and goal setting, this quote can serve as a guiding principle for individuals striving to make meaningful changes in their lives. It encourages individuals to take ownership of their aspirations and actively work towards their fulfillment. By recognizing the correlation between effort and desire, individuals can gain clarity on their priorities and pursue their goals with purpose and dedication.

In conclusion, Peter McWilliams' quote "If you're not actively involved in getting what you want, you don't really want it" encapsulates the essence of authentic desire and proactive pursuit. It challenges individuals to evaluate the sincerity of their aspirations and underscores the importance of active engagement and effort in achieving their goals. Ultimately, this quote serves as a poignant reminder of the intrinsic connection between genuine desire and tangible action in the pursuit of fulfillment and success.
